Convertir efficacement LaTeX en PDF en Java

Introduction

Bienvenue dans ce guide complet sur la conversion efficace de LaTeX en PDF en Java à l’aide d’Aspose.TeX pour Java. Aspose.TeX est une bibliothèque puissante qui offre des capacités de conversion transparentes, vous permettant de transformer facilement des documents LaTeX au format PDF. Dans ce didacticiel, nous vous guiderons pas à pas tout au long du processus, en veillant à ce que vous maîtrisiez parfaitement chaque concept.

Conditions préalables

Avant de nous lancer dans le processus de conversion, assurez-vous que les conditions préalables suivantes sont remplies :

  • Environnement de développement Java : assurez-vous d’avoir configuré un environnement de développement Java sur votre système.

  • Bibliothèque Aspose.TeX pour Java : téléchargez et installez la bibliothèque Aspose.TeX pour Java. Vous pouvez trouver la bibliothèque et les ressources associées dans leDocumentation . Utilisez lelien de téléchargement pour obtenir la bibliothèque.

  • Configuration de la licence : utilisez leUtils.setLicense(); méthode pour configurer votre licence, garantissant un processus de conversion fluide. Vous pouvez acquérir une licence ou une licence temporaireici oupermis temporaire.

Maintenant que nous avons mis en ordre nos prérequis, passons aux étapes suivantes.

Importer des packages

Dans cette étape, nous importerons les packages nécessaires pour lancer le processus de conversion. L’extrait de code suivant illustre l’importation du package pour la conversion LaTeX en PDF :

package com.aspose.tex.LaTeXPdfConversionSimplest;

import java.io.IOException;

import com.aspose.tex.OutputFileSystemDirectory;
import com.aspose.tex.TeXConfig;
import com.aspose.tex.TeXJob;
import com.aspose.tex.TeXOptions;
import com.aspose.tex.rendering.PdfDevice;
import com.aspose.tex.rendering.PdfSaveOptions;

import util.Utils;

Maintenant, décomposons le processus de conversion en plusieurs étapes :

Étape 1 : Configurer les options de conversion

TeXOptions options = TeXOptions.consoleAppOptions(TeXConfig.objectLaTeX());

Dans cette étape, nous configurons les options de conversion, en spécifiant le format Object LaTeX.

Étape 2 : définir le répertoire de travail de sortie

options.setOutputWorkingDirectory(new OutputFileSystemDirectory("Your Output Directory"));

Définissez le répertoire de travail du système de fichiers dans lequel le fichier PDF converti sera enregistré.

Étape 3 : initialiser les options d’enregistrement PDF

options.setSaveOptions(new PdfSaveOptions());

Initialisez les options d’enregistrement du document au format PDF.

Étape 4 : Exécutez la conversion LaTeX en PDF

new TeXJob("Your Input Directory" + "hello-world.ltx", new PdfDevice(), options).run();

Exécutez le processus de conversion proprement dit, en fournissant le répertoire d’entrée et le fichier LaTeX.

Toutes nos félicitations! Vous avez converti avec succès un document LaTeX en PDF à l’aide d’Aspose.TeX pour Java.

Conclusion

Dans ce didacticiel, nous avons couvert les étapes essentielles pour convertir efficacement LaTeX en PDF à l’aide d’Aspose.TeX pour Java. En suivant le guide fourni, vous pouvez intégrer de manière transparente cette fonctionnalité dans vos applications Java.

FAQ

Q1 : Puis-je utiliser Aspose.TeX pour Java sans licence ?

A1 : Bien que vous puissiez utiliser Aspose.TeX pour Java sans licence, il est recommandé d’en obtenir une pour des performances optimales et pour débloquer des fonctionnalités avancées.

Q2 : Existe-t-il un essai gratuit disponible pour Aspose.TeX pour Java ?

A2 : Oui, vous pouvez accéder à un essai gratuitici.

Q3 : Comment puis-je obtenir une assistance pour Aspose.TeX pour Java ?

A3 : Vous pouvez demander de l’aide sur leForum Aspose.TeX.

Q4 : Où puis-je trouver de la documentation supplémentaire pour Aspose.TeX pour Java ?

A4 : Une documentation détaillée est disponibleici.

Q5 : Puis-je acheter Aspose.TeX pour Java ?

A5 : Oui, vous pouvez acheter une licenceici.